Subject: Handover — Thistledown component library

Hi Marlo,

Taking over the plugin registry duties from me means watching the Thistledown versioning tables. Plugin authors pin against major versions only; the compatibility matrix is regenerated nightly from the registry database. If the matrix looks stale, rerun the generator manually. For that you'll need read access to the registry, reachable via the connection string below.

replica DSN, kajep-yahag: mssql://praok_svc:iF@db-8d68.plorvaio.local:5432/eliion

Welcome to Merrivale Systems. As part of the Project Gatewing upgrade, the turnstiles in the Elm Street lobby were replaced last quarter with proximity readers. New starters should tap their badge flat against the reader panel and wait for the green indicator before pushing through; tapping twice in quick succession locks the lane for thirty seconds. Until your personal badge is printed, use the temporary starter pass issued below.

turnstile pass: bdg-QZV-3

The Fernlatch tax-rate lookup cache holds jurisdiction rates for 24 hours. During a release, flush the cache only after the rate-table migration completes, otherwise stale rates can persist into the new build. Confirm the flush with the verification script before sign-off. The flush procedure and rollback steps are on the internal page here.

dashboard of haweg-yaguf = https://confluence.tolvaqlabs.internal/browse/browse/display/77f0a7ad

Packets are validated, deduplicated against a rolling window, and written to the staging log before acknowledgment; unacknowledged packets are retransmitted by the device firmware. Buffer depths, window sizes, and acknowledgment timeouts were chosen from harvest-season traces collected near Dunmere, and changing any of them requires a replay test. The current tuning constants are as follows.

tuning constants:
QUOTAS = {
    "druwyn": 5,
    "holix": 5,
    "zorath": 5,
    "holwyn": 10,
}